The greatest flamenco dancers and … WebMar 13, 2024 · The Peña Torres Macarena is a renowned flamenco venue in the historic neighborhood of La Macarena in Seville. Established in 1964, the theater was originally a local social club where flamenco fans gathered to enjoy impromptu performances by some of the city's most talented artists.

The actual route and times of the Semana Santa processions is different every year. They are decided at a meeting called the ‘Cabildo de Toma de Horas’ which takes place on whatever date falls 14 days before Palm Sunday.
